This appliance is marked according to the European directive 2012/19/EU on Waste Electrical and Electronic Equipment (WEEE). WEEE contains both polluting substances (which can cause negative consequences for the environment) and basic components (which can be re-used). It is important to have WEEE subjected to specific treatments, in order to remove and dispose properly all pollutants, and recover and recycle all materials. Individuals can play an important role in ensuring that WEEE does not become an environmental issue; it is essential to follow some basic rules: In many countries, when you buy a new appliance, the old one may be returned to the retailer who has to collect it free of charge on a one-to-one basis, as long as the equipment is of equivalent type and has the same functions as the supplied equipment. If the plug we supply does not fit : Control panel Turning the appliance ON: Plug the appliance in, if all the temperature indicators LEDs are off, press ON/OFF (3) for 1 second. When you release the ON/OFF button (3) a temperature light will come on and the appliance will beep. Turning the appliance OFF: Press the ON/OFF button (3) for 1 second, when you release it, the temperature light will go out and the appliance will beep. In the event of a power failure, when the power comes back on, the appliance will run using the last saved setting. Press the button for setting the temperature until you reach the level you want where level 1 is the warmest and level 4 is the coldest. Under normal operating conditions, we recommend using an intermediate setting (level 2) [Temperature control interface: Buttons 1, 2, 3, 4] Press button (2) for less than 2 seconds to change the temperature level. Use this menu to set an intermediate level. [Temperature control interface: Buttons 1, 2, 3, 4] Press button (2) for more than 2 seconds. When you release it, LED 2 will flash [Temperature control interface: Buttons 1, 2, 3, 4] The next time you press button (2) for less than 2 seconds, the intermediate level will be set. This operation works in cycles every time you press the button. [Temperature control interface: Buttons 1, 2, 3, 4] If you do not press the button (2) for more than 5 seconds, the settings will be saved. The temperature levels in advanced settings are set from warmest to coldest e.g. 2/2.1/2.3/2.4 which means there are 4 sub-levels for every main level. If the door is left open for longer than 90 seconds, an alarm is sounded. To turn it off, simply close the door or press button 2. Important: if your ambient temperature is high, the appliance may operate continuously, thus building up excessive frost on the inner wall of the fridge. In this case, turn the fridge knob to a warmer setting (1-2). During normal functioning, the refrigerator is automatically defrosted. There is no need to dry the drops of water present on the rear wall or to eliminate the frost (depending on functioning). The water is conveyed to the rear part through the drain hole found there and the heat of the compressor causes it to evaporate. Defrosting of the fridge compartment occurs automatically in this product. A small amount of frost or drops of water on the back of the fridge compartment when the fridge is working is normal. Make sure the water outlet is always clean and make sure foods do not touch the back or sides of the fridge compartment. We recommend you defrost the freezer area when the layer of frost is more than 3 mm thick. When the layer of frost present in the freezer compartment exceeds 3mm, it is recommended to proceed with the defrosting as it increases energy consumption. Absolutely avoid the use of open flames or electrical appliances, such as heaters, steam cleaners, candles, oil lamps and the like to accelerate the defrosting phase. Do not scrape with a knife or sharp object to remove frost or ice present. These can damage the refrigerant circuit, the leakage of which can cause a fire or damage your eyes.d. Adjust middle hinge for wall mounting.] The appliance is equipped with coupling devices for the appliance doors with the column panels (loader slide). Secure the slide in the inner part of the panel of the built-in column at the desired height and at approx. 20 mm. From the outer wire of the door. [Diagram description: Illustration showing how to secure the slide in the column panel and connect the appliance door to the cabinet panel using loader slots.] Once the product has been embedded, place the rear part of the column in contact with the wall so as to prevent access to the compressor compartment. For the product to operate correctly it is essential to allow adequate air circulation so as to cool down the condenser located in the rear part of the appliance. For this reason, the column must be equipped with a rear chimney, whose upper opening must not be blocked and with a front slot which will be covered with a ventilation grill.
